The Future/Metro Boomin featuring Kendrick Lamar track “Like That” kicked the Drake vs. Everbody beef into high gear.

It was also a number-one hit.

Drake’s retort, “Push Ups,” may end up doing better.

It will be tough for any non-Taylor Swift song to top the chart for the next few weeks.

But “Like That” and “Push Ups” certainly prove rap beef can result in hits.
